Etymology Explorer › Old ArmenianWhere does “խթան” come from? խթան (Old Armenian) comes from Old Armenian խթեմ, from Old Armenian խիթ, from Proto-Indo-European kh₂id-to-, from Proto-Indo-European kh₂eyd- — to cut, hew.
խթան (Old Armenian): spur, goad; spur, incentive; butting
Definitions spur, goad; spur, incentive; butting Ancestry of “խթան”, step by step խթան traces back through two separate lines of ancestry.
via Old Armenian խթեմ Step Language Word Meaning 1 Old Armenian խթեմ to bite; to goad, to push, to shove, to spur, to... 2 Old Armenian խիթ pain, colic, twinge; rock, reef; crocodile 3 Proto-Indo-European kh₂id-to- — 4 Proto-Indo-European kh₂eyd- to cut, hew
